#104 - Lowfat Chocolate Cake

I made this a week or so ago and just realized I hadn't posted the recipe :) This is like the yellow/white lowfat cake only difference is to use a dark soda instead of a lemon-lime one.

Just mix 12 ounces of the dark pop with a chocolate cake mix. That's all - no more ingredients. Don't over mix it. It seems that the more you mix it the less it will rise. Spread it in your pan of choice and bake as directed on the box. Here it is after it's baked! We were bad and actually used some chocolate icing.
